The extraordinary story of Gloucester housewife Janet Leach who played a key role in the uncovering of the crimes of Fred and Rosemary West.
2 Episodes
Fred West
Janet Leach
Detective Superintendent John Bennett
Rose West
Mike
Detective Constabe Darren Law
Howard Ogden
Mae West
Stephen West
Detective Constable Hazel Savage
2001
1995
2014
2024
2022
2020
2006
2019
1988
1985
1992
1998
1991
2021
1990
2025
2013
2009
2017
2015
1996
2023
2018
2016
2008
2005